Definition & Core Features of the Driver Vehicle Inspection Report Form

The Driver Vehicle Inspection Report (DVIR) form is essential for ensuring the safety and operational readiness of vehicles. It mandates that drivers assess and note the condition of various truck and trailer components, documenting any defects or issues that could affect vehicle performance or safety. This thorough check includes tires, brakes, lights, and the steering mechanism, among others. The DVIR serves not only as a vehicle maintenance tool but also as a compliance document that satisfies regulatory requirements in the transportation industry.

Steps to Complete the Printable Driver Vehicle Inspection Report Form

  1. Initial Inspection: Begin by examining all vehicle facets as prescribed by the DVIR, checking each part systematically to ensure it meets safety standards.

  2. Document Defective Items: If any defects are discovered, populate the defective items section with detailed descriptions.

  3. Assess Overall Condition: After inspecting individual components, provide an assessment of the vehicle's overall condition.

  4. Add Remarks: Include any additional remarks that might not fit into other sections of the form, such as potential repairs or maintenance needs.

  5. Sign the Report: Ensure that both the driver and the mechanic, if involved, sign off on the report. The signatures confirm that necessary repairs have been completed or that the vehicle is safe to operate despite identified defects.

Key Elements of the Printable Driver Vehicle Inspection Report Form

  • Vehicle Information: Includes fields for the vehicle identification number, make, model, and license number.

  • List of Components: Covers all critical truck and trailer parts that require inspection, such as brakes, lights, and mirrors.

  • Defect Reporting Section: A dedicated area for listing discovered defects or issues.

  • Remarks: A section for additional notes and observations regarding vehicle condition or maintenance needs.

  • Signatures: The report requires driver and possibly mechanic signatures for validation.

  • Corrective Actions: Space for noting any corrective measures taken or needed to address reported defects.

Who Typically Uses the Printable Driver Vehicle Inspection Report Form

This form is predominantly utilized by commercial vehicle drivers and fleet operators. It plays a critical role in daily operations for industries relying on logistics and transportation services. Both individual owner-operators and large trucking companies use the DVIR to comply with safety standards set by regulatory bodies like the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A).

Legal Use and Compliance of the Printable Driver Vehicle Inspection Report Form

The DVIR is a legal requirement under United States regulations, specifically mandated by the FMCSA to ensure road safety and vehicle integrity. Truck drivers and fleet operators must complete and retain this report as part of their operational records. Compliance helps in avoiding penalties and ensures that any detected vehicle issues are addressed without delay, maintaining the safety of the vehicle and thereby the safety of public roadways.

Digital vs. Paper Version of the Printable Driver Vehicle Inspection Report Form

The DVIR can be managed electronically or completed in a traditional paper format. The digital version offers advantages, such as easy storage, quick access, and seamless integration with fleet management systems. It allows for real-time updates and better collaboration among teams and maintenance personnel, making it more environmentally friendly. Conversely, paper forms may be preferred in scenarios where digital technology is not feasible or during field inspections in remote areas without internet access.

Completing a driver vehicle inspection report is as simple as 4 basic steps: STEP 1: VEHICLE INSPECTION. This is the drivers time to circle a vehicle for a thorough analysis of its working order. STEP 2: REPORT DEFECTS. STEP 3: SIGN OFF ON THE REPORT. STEP 4: CORRECTIVE ACTION AND SIGN-OFF ON REPAIRS.
